Search options

  what is this?

Start again

Wlm Baits, Leicester, Leicestershire

Wlm Baits

add or edit your shop

660 - 662 Aylestone Road
Leicester
Leicestershire
LE2 8PR

Telephone: 01163 192 930

How to find us

Directions to this business

-1.1548 52.6026